1. The Grand Ole Opry
A Historic Landmark
The Grand Ole Opry is not just a venue; it's a historic landmark that has been the heart of country music since 1925. This weekly country music stage concert features a mix of famous artists and newcomers, making it a must-visit for any music enthusiast.
What to Expect
When you attend a show at the Grand Ole Opry, you can expect a lively atmosphere filled with the sounds of live performances. The venue also offers backstage tours, allowing you to see where legends have performed.

3. Ryman Auditorium
The Mother Church of Country Music
Ryman Auditorium, often referred to as the "Mother Church of Country Music," is renowned for its incredible acoustics and rich history. Originally built as a tabernacle in the 1890s, it has hosted countless legendary performances.
What to Expect
Whether you're attending a concert or taking a guided tour, the Ryman offers a glimpse into Nashville's musical heritage. The venue hosts a variety of genres, so there's something for everyone.

6. Exit/In
A Nashville Institution
Exit/In is a Nashville institution that has been a staple in the live music scene since 1971. Known for its eclectic lineup, this venue has hosted everyone from Johnny Cash to The White Stripes.
What to Expect
Expect a lively atmosphere with a mix of local and national acts. Exit/In is known for its commitment to supporting emerging artists, making it a great place to discover new music.
